A man is driven to murder by the "evil eye" of the old man for whom he works. For several nights he looks in on the old man, but each night he finds the eye closed. On the eighth night he finds the eye wide open and staring. Driven to madness, he murders the old man and disposes the cut-up corpse under the floor boards of the old man's bedroom. The next morning, the police come to investigate a scream heard by a neighbor, the murderer brings them into the bedroom and visits with them. Soon, the murderer insanely imagines that he can hear the beating of the old man's heart and becomes convinced that the police also hear it.
